trconvert

Summary

Convert a grammar from one for to another

Description

Reads a grammar from stdin and converts the grammar to/from Antlr version 4 syntax. The original grammar must be for a supported type (Antlr2, Antlr3, Bison, W3C EBNF, Lark). The input and output are Parse Tree Data.

Usage

trconvert [-t <type>]

Details

This command converts a grammar from one type to another. Most conversions will handle only simple syntax differences. More complicated scenarios are supported depending on the source and target grammar types. For example, Bison is converted to Antlr4, but the reverse is not implemented yet.

trconvert takes an option target type. If it is not used, the default is to convert the input of whatever type to Antlr4 syntax. The output of trconvert is a parse tree containing the converted grammar.

Examples

Conversion of Antlr4 Abnf to Lark Abnf

grammar Abnf;

rulelist : rule_* EOF ;
rule_ : ID '=' '/'? elements ;
elements : alternation ;
alternation : concatenation ( '/' concatenation )* ;
concatenation : repetition + ;
repetition : repeat_? element ;
repeat_ : INT | ( INT? '*' INT? ) ;
element : ID | group | option | STRING | NumberValue | ProseValue ;
group : '(' alternation ')' ;
option : '[' alternation ']' ;
NumberValue : '%' ( BinaryValue | DecimalValue | HexValue ) ;
fragment BinaryValue : 'b' BIT+ ( ( '.' BIT+ )+ | ( '-' BIT+ ) )? ;
fragment DecimalValue : 'd' DIGIT+ ( ( '.' DIGIT+ )+ | ( '-' DIGIT+ ) )? ;
fragment HexValue : 'x' HEX_DIGIT+ ( ( '.' HEX_DIGIT+ )+ | ( '-' HEX_DIGIT+ ) )? ;
ProseValue : '<' ( ~ '>' )* '>' ;
ID : LETTER ( LETTER | DIGIT | '-' )* ;
INT : '0' .. '9'+ ;
COMMENT : ';' ~ ( '\n' | '\r' )* '\r'? '\n' -> channel ( HIDDEN ) ;
WS : ( ' ' | '\t' | '\r' | '\n' ) -> channel ( HIDDEN ) ;
STRING : ( '%s' | '%i' )? '"' ( ~ '"' )* '"' ;
fragment LETTER : 'a' .. 'z' | 'A' .. 'Z' ;
fragment BIT : '0' .. '1' ;
fragment DIGIT : '0' .. '9' ;
fragment HEX_DIGIT : ( '0' .. '9' | 'a' .. 'f' | 'A' .. 'F' ) ;

Command

trparse Abnf.g4 | trconvert -t lark | trprint > Abnf.lark

Output

rulelist :  rule_ * EOF 
rule_ :  ID "=" "/" ? elements 
elements :  alternation 
alternation :  concatenation ( "/" concatenation ) * 
concatenation :  repetition + 
repetition :  repeat_ ? element 
repeat_ :  INT | ( INT ? "*" INT ? ) 
element :  ID | group | option | STRING | NUMBERVALUE | PROSEVALUE 
group :  "(" alternation ")" 
option :  "[" alternation "]" 
NUMBERVALUE :  "%" ( BINARYVALUE | DECIMALVALUE | HEXVALUE ) 
BINARYVALUE :  "b" BIT + ( ( "." BIT + ) + | ( "-" BIT + ) ) ? 
DECIMALVALUE :  "d" DIGIT + ( ( "." DIGIT + ) + | ( "-" DIGIT + ) ) ? 
HEXVALUE :  "x" HEX_DIGIT + ( ( "." HEX_DIGIT + ) + | ( "-" HEX_DIGIT + ) ) ? 
PROSEVALUE :  "<" ( /(?!>)/ ) * ">" 
ID :  LETTER ( LETTER | DIGIT | "-" ) * 
INT :  "0" .. "9" + 
COMMENT :  ";" /(?!\n|\r)/ * "\r" ? "\n" 
WS :  ( " " | "\t" | "\r" | "\n" ) 
STRING :  ( "%s" | "%i" ) ? "\"" ( /(?!")/ ) * "\"" 
LETTER :  "a" .. "z" | "A" .. "Z" 
BIT :  "0" .. "1" 
DIGIT :  "0" .. "9" 
HEX_DIGIT :  ( "0" .. "9" | "a" .. "f" | "A" .. "F" ) 

%ignore COMMENT
%ignore WS
